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Conservative Balance SheetPark’s very low leverage and large liquid reserves provide durable financial flexibility to fund operations, absorb shocks, and support staged capacity investments or opportunistic buybacks. Over the next 2–6 months this reduces refinancing risk and preserves optionality for expansion or downturns.
Sole‑source Defense PositionsExclusive qualification on PAC‑3 and other missile systems creates high barriers to entry and stable, defense‑driven demand. This structural position supports repeatable order flow, stronger margin potential on finished parts, and predictable medium‑term revenue tied to DoD replenishment initiatives.
Revenue Recovery With Solid MarginsRevenue rebound to $73.3M alongside healthy gross and operating margins indicates improving product mix and pricing power in core specialty materials. Combined with a free‑cash‑flow rebound, this strengthens the company’s ability to invest in capacity and sustain operations over the medium term.
Bears Say
C2B Capacity ConstraintsCritical C2B fabric capacity limits ability to convert demand into revenue. Multi‑year timeline to establish U.S. production creates a durable supply constraint risk that can cap growth, force reliance on imports, and slow revenue recognition for missile and commercial programs over the next several quarters.
Potentially Rising Capital RequirementsManagement signaled the new plant and related investments will likely exceed initial budgets, which could require additional funding. Over 2–6 months this raises execution risk: delays, dilution via equity raises, or added leverage could constrain returns and slow the company’s ability to meet accelerating demand.
Margin Volatility From Product MixLarge, low‑markup C2B fabric sales and stockpiling have temporarily suppressed margins and produced uneven earnings and cash conversion. This product‑mix driven margin volatility can persist while inventory converts to higher‑margin finished parts, creating short‑to‑medium term earnings unpredictability.

Company Description
Park Electrochemical Corp
Park Aerospace Corp. (PKE) is a manufacturer and innovator of advanced composite materials. Utilizing both solution and hot-melt processes, the company crafts these materials into composite structures primarily for the aerospace market, serving clients across North America, Asia, and Europe. Its portfolio of advanced composites features critical products such as film adhesives and lightning strike protection materials. These are essential for fabricating both primary and secondary structural components found in diverse aircraft types, including jet engines, large and regional airliners, military aircraft, un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s), business jets, general aviation planes, and rotary-wing aircraft. Additionally, PKE provides specialized ablative materials for rocket motors and nozzles, alongside custom-engineered solutions for radome applications. The company also offers design and fabrication services for composite parts, assemblies, and structures, as well as low-volume tooling solutions for the aerospace sector. Founded in 1954 and based in Westbury, New York, the organization was previously known as Park Electrochemical Corp. before adopting its current name, Park Aerospace Corp., in July 2019.

The call conveyed a generally positive outlook anchored by strong cash, no long‑term debt, sole‑source positions (notably C2B/PAC‑3), a fiscal 2026 revenue breakout ($73.3M), and significant demand tailwinds from missile stockpile replenishment and major commercial aircraft programs. Offsetting risks include near‑term margin pressure from low‑markup fabric sales, supply‑chain/missed shipment disruptions, critical capacity constraints for C2B that require multi‑year investments, and likely higher capital needs beyond current cash balances.
